Q: Why is the first request to a Skylift handler so slow?

A: That's a cold start — the runtime has to spin up a fresh worker, which can add a few seconds. It's normal after deploys or quiet periods, not a bug. If a customer complains, the warm-up options and tuning guide are on the internal page here.

operations page: https://jenkins.zemvarcloud.local/job/merge_requests/repo/build/73930b4b30f0a8ed

**Mgmt Meeting Minutes — Retiring the Brightline Range**

Quick recap for sales leads at Fenholt Supplies: we agreed to retire the Brightline fixture range by year-end. Remaining stock moves to clearance pricing next month, and accounts on standing orders get migrated to the Lumetta range. Trade-in incentives were approved in principle. The confidential note on next steps sits just below.

board note of bajof-bajeg: The pricing group signed off on a budget of $13.4 million for Project Sildor. The renewal with Lamixek Holdings closes at $48.9 million a year, 49 percent above the last contract.

Subject: Handover — Stockmender reconciliation job

Hey, quick handover before I'm out. The Stockmender inventory reconciliation job runs nightly at 02:10 and has been clean all week. If it fails, just rerun it — it's idempotent. One thing: the signed deploy for the hotfix is still queued, so you may need to push it yourself Thursday. The deploy key it expects is below.

signing key of kahog-kadup = bky13_6wLyxnPsJob4P